The other day I dropped out of SC at my current "local" outpost and was surprised to find it allied to me. Checked the details and instead of being aligned to the local reigning independent faction it just said "Federation".
Left the instance. Came back. It was back to normal, not allied to me and correctly aligned to the local faction. Did my business at the station (flush, wash hands!) and then as I was leaving the FSD countdown was ticking, 3 ... 2 ... outpost turned green ... 1 ... what the?
I initially put this down to a bug. However, the controlling faction was marked as pending CIVIL UNREST. Was the control of the outpost actually swapping due to the unrest or was it a bug?
If it was a bug, perhaps this could explain some of the weird station deaths that people experience if the station can suddenly ally itself to a faction you're hostile with!
